In the quiet, early hours of a rainy April morning in Enfield, Connecticut, Awilda Marrero vanished from her home on Asnuntuck Street. The 43-year-old was last seen by her daughter around 11:30 p.m. on April 6, 2009. When her family awoke the next day, she was gone. She had stepped out into the night leaving behind all of her personal belongings, including her purse and cell phone.
